After great seasons filled with fun and excitement, the EGR Boys and Girls basketball teams are heading to the playoffs.

The boys finished the regular with a solid record of 12-6. They are coming off of a huge win against Grand Rapids Christian which is giving them momentum heading into the playoffs. The boys will be taking on Forest Hills Central in the first round.

“We are pretty excited going into playoffs,” Marty Ward ‘18 said. “We have beaten Forest Hills Central once and we are confident that we can do it again.”

The girls had a very impressive season, finishing 16-3 in the regular season. Some of their highlight wins throughout the season were against Rockford and South Christian. On senior night, the girls also won a big game against Grand Rapids Christian. They are preparing to take on Greenville in the first round of the playoffs.

“Going into playoffs we are feeling pretty confident,” Mary Schumar ‘19 said. “We haven’t lost a game since the beginning of January and we are feeling good about how we will play during playoffs.”

Both the boys and the girls have been working hard to get ready for the playoffs. The girls’ run begins Feb. 26, and the boys’ run begins Feb. 28.
